To a solution of PPh3 (20.64 g, 78.68 mmol) in THF (30 rnL) was added DIAD ( 15.91 g, 78.68 mmol, 15.30 mL), 3 -methyl -4-nitro- lH-pyrazole (5 g, 39.34 mmol) and oxetan-3-ol (2.91 g, 39.34 mmol) at 0C. Then the mixture was stirred at 25C for 12 h. The mixture was concentrated under reduced pressure. The residue was purified by silica gel column chromatography (S1Q2, PE:EtOAc = 50: 1 to 5 : 1). The mixture of 3-methy]-4-nitro-l -(oxetan-3-yl)pyrazole and 5 -methyl -4-nitro- 1 -(oxetan-3-yl)pyrazole was obtained as a yellow solid. To a solution of Pd/C (3 g, 10% purity) in MeOH (lOmL) was added 3 -methyl -4-nitro- l-(oxetan-3- yl)pyrazole and 5-methyl-4-nitro-l-(oxetan-3-yl)pyrazole (5 g, 37,3 mmol), then the mixture was stirred at 25C under (15 psi) for 2 h. The reaction was filtered and the filtrate was concentrated under reduced pressure to give 3 -methyl- l-(oxetan-3-yl)pyrazol-4-amine and 5-methyl- l-(oxetan-3-yl)-pyrazol- -I -am ine as a dark brown oil.
